FLUMAN v. TSS DEP'T STORES


100 A.D.2d 838 (1984)

Gary Fluman, Individually and as Administrator of The Estate of Theresa Fluman, Deceased, Appellant, v. TSS Department Stores, Defendant and Third-Party Plaintiff-Respondent. Advanced Cleaners, Third-Party Defendant-Respondent

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

April 2, 1984


No appeal lies from an order denying reargument (see Matter of Kingsbrook Jewish Med.
